The 188-bed hotel would contain a coffee lounge connected to a first-floor bar and restaurant with a gym on the second floor for hotel guests only.The site in the Greengate area of Salford neighbours the Citysuites Aparthotel, which is owned by the company behind the Embankment West towers.Select Property Group, which is currently constructing the residential blocks to the north of the Maldron site, objected to the proposals for the new hotel.Speaking on behalf of the developer at a planning panel meeting on Thursday (February 4), Dan Jestico, Director of Futures at Iceni Projects, said the new hotel would have a 'detrimental impact' on these neighbouring buildings.He highlighted loss of light and overlooking as his client's key.
